XCS40XL-3PQ208I: High-Performance Spartan-XL FPGA for Industrial Applications

Product Details

Product Overview: XCS40XL-3PQ208I FPGA Solution

The XCS40XL-3PQ208I is a versatile Field Programmable Gate Array (FPGA) from AMD Xilinx’s renowned Spartan-XL family, designed to deliver reliable performance for embedded systems and industrial control applications. This FPGA combines advanced programmable logic with cost-effective design, making it an ideal choice for engineers seeking flexible digital circuit solutions.

Key Specifications and Technical Features

Core Architecture and Performance

Specification Details
Logic Gates 40,000 system gates
Logic Cells 1,862 cells
Configurable Logic Blocks (CLBs) 784 CLBs
Maximum Frequency 125 MHz
Technology CMOS
Operating Voltage 3.3V
Speed Grade -3 (industrial grade)

Package and Environmental Specifications

Parameter Value
Package Type 208-Pin PQFP (Plastic Quad Flat Pack)
I/O Pins 124 user I/O pins
Operating Temperature Range -40°C to +100°C (Industrial)
Mounting Type Surface Mount
Package Dimensions 28mm x 28mm body

Programming and Configuration

Configuration Methods

The XCS40XL-3PQ208I supports multiple configuration modes:

  1. Master Serial Mode: FPGA controls external PROM
  2. Slave Serial Mode: External controller provides bitstream
  3. Boundary Scan (JTAG): In-system programming and debugging
  4. Master Parallel Mode: Fast configuration from parallel memory

Configuration Memory

  • External serial PROM required for standalone operation
  • Bitstream size: Approximately 320 Kb
  • Configuration time: Typically less than 100ms

Ordering Information and Availability

Part Number Breakdown

XCS40XL-3PQ208I

  • XCS40XL: Spartan-XL family, 40K gates
  • 3: Speed grade (-3)
  • PQ208: Package type (208-pin PQFP)
  • I: Industrial temperature range

Related Part Numbers

Part Number Description
XCS40XL-4PQ208I Faster speed grade (-4) variant
XCS40XL-3PQ208C Commercial temperature range
XCS40XL-3BG256I Alternative 256-pin BGA package
